Leucorrhea and backache may be gynecological inflammation, including vaginitis, cervix and pelvic inflammatory disease. Therefore, you should go to the hospital for examination in time. First, do a gynecological examination to find out whether there is vaginal bleeding, the color characteristics of vaginal secretions, and whether there is inflammation in the cervix. There are no abnormal lesions. Whether there is tenderness in the uterus, whether there is tenderness in the adnexal areas on both sides, etc. based on the test results, a further clear diagnosis is made and vaginal secretions are examined. If necessary, vaginal secretions are cultured and drug sensitivity is added. In order to understand whether there is pelvic inflammation or there is no abnormal space-occupying lesions, it is recommended to do pelvic color Doppler examination. According to the above results to further clarify the diagnosis, if it is considered pelvic inflammation, it is recommended to give timely anti-inflammatory treatment. Because if there is vaginal inflammation, determine the type of vaginitis to choose specific medication, vaginal inflammation control after cervical cancer screening, including cervical cell fluid examination, hpv detection when necessary colposcopy and cervical biopsy.
